As an attorney who provided legal representation
to both police and security entities, Dr. Pastor has developed
a public safety legal niche. He provides presentations and training
on a variety of legal issues. For examples

As an author who has developed cutting edge
analysis of contemporary policing, Dr. Pastor has the credentials,
experiences and ability to articulate the increasing interrelationship
between police and private security. The significance of these
relationships will form the basis for a new policing model.

As a former gang crimes tactical police officer,
security consultant, and a professor in public safety, Dr. Pastor
provides a unique perspective with cutting edge and dynamic
